PCI Express 在嵌入式系统中的应用.docx
-
资源ID:17770691
资源大小:18.59KB
全文页数:7页
- 资源格式: DOCX
下载积分:15.18金币
快捷下载
![游客一键下载](/images/hot.gif)
会员登录下载
微信登录下载
三方登录下载:
微信扫一扫登录
友情提示
2、PDF文件下载后,可能会被浏览器默认打开,此种情况可以点击浏览器菜单,保存网页到桌面,就可以正常下载了。
3、本站不支持迅雷下载,请使用电脑自带的IE浏览器,或者360浏览器、谷歌浏览器下载即可。
4、本站资源下载后的文档和图纸-无水印,预览文档经过压缩,下载后原文更清晰。
5、试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。
|
PCI Express 在嵌入式系统中的应用.docx
PCIExpress在嵌入式系统中的应用ronggang导语:本文从目前应用的需要出发,说明了PCIExpress连接技术出现的必要;分析了PCIExpress连接技术的特性;并把它与PCI总线技术进展比拟,给出其在嵌入式系统中的应用拓扑构造图摘要:本文从目前应用的需要出发,说明了PCIExpress连接技术出现的必要;分析了PCIExpress连接技术的特性;并把它与PCI总线技术进展比拟,给出其在嵌入式系统中的应用拓扑构造图。最后描绘了目前各芯片厂商针对PCIExpress连接技术提供的不同芯片。关键词:PCIExpress内部互联高速串行总线PCI总线PCI-X在过去几十年里,PCI总线是一种非常成功的通用I/O总线标准,尤其在嵌入式系统应用中,经常会看到PCI总线的踪影,但它将不能知足将来计算机设备的带宽需要。随着制造工艺的开展,将会出现10GHz的CPU,高速的内存和显卡,甚至1Gbps和10Gbps的网卡等其他需要“无限内部带宽的设备。由Intel公司推出的第三代I/O总线构造PCIExpress3GIO就是顺应这种需要产生的。它不但能与原来的PCI设备兼容工作,还可以增强原有设备的性能。其特点就是高性能,高扩展性,高可靠性,好的晋级性及低的本钱12。2002年7月23日,PCI-SIG正式公布了PCIExpress1.0标准,并且根据其开发蓝图,将在2006年正式推出2.0标准。PCIExpress有两个版本:根底版和交换版。根底版的特点是:与PCI软件兼容;很少的引脚数目串行;高速率2.5Gbps/通道;可扩展到32通道;CRC链路,端到端;热插拔;QoSQualityofService才能。交换版的特点是:物理层和数据链路层与根本版兼容;基于源的路由;多协议封装;堵塞治理;多播/播送。PCIExpress的拓扑构造包括一个主桥和假设干终点EndPoint对应假设干输入输出设备,见图1。多点对点联结技术将新的特性-开关技术-引入了输入输出总线拓扑构造。开关技术替换了原来的多点复用multi-drop总线技术,在不同的终点间它提供对等联结的方式,将各个终点的数据分开传输,最后汇总到主桥内3。align=center图1PCIExpress的拓扑构造/alignPCIExpress的根本特征:串行LVDS链接,见图2;align=center图2PCIExpress的串行LVDS链接/align基于互换的拓扑构造;每个通道的每个方向数据传输速率为2.5Gbps;最高连接通道为32个;带宽可扩展最大×32。CRC链路,端到端;热插拔;NTB链接的多HOST构造;与PCI/X兼容;电源治理。下表中列出了PCIExpress特点所带来的使用上的优点。表二是将PCIExpress与PCI/X进展的比照。注1.并行总线通常包含地址/数据信号和一些边带信号。边带信号用来表示总线上数据的方向和事务处理的类型,还能用于表示中断或者总线主控恳求。注2.一个典型的PCIExpress连接使用两个LVDS低电压差分信号对,一对用于发送,一对用于接收。在这个构造中没有边带信号,见图3。3align=centeralign=center图3典型的PCIExpress连接/align图4PCIExpress在嵌入式控制系统的应用/align注3.PCIExpress信道能聚集以增加总带宽,可用的带宽直接与通道的数目成比例。其有效组合为×1,×2,×4,×8,×12,×16,×32,通道数加倍带宽也加倍。如一个10Gbps的以太网控制器可以使用4条PCIExpress来与控制器的带宽相匹配。由于PCIExpress的突出特性,决定了它可以用于很多领域,诸如效劳器、成像系统、存储系统、通讯系统、工业控制等,影响比拟大的可能还是嵌入式系统,图4给出了其应用于嵌入式系统的应用拓扑构造。可以看出,在这种拓扑构造中本地端设备通过PCIExpress桥连接在一起,不再是通过PCI桥连接。依靠开关技术,本地端设备就可以“无限的扇出,且传输速率不会下降,而传统的依靠PCI桥连接的设备由于多点复用总线技术的限制,每一路本地端设备的传输速率会下降。在嵌入式应用方面,另外一个比拟让人关注的应该是ExpressCard,这种具有USB2.0接口的小型卡,其硬件本钱低,功能性好,将会取代粗笨的PC卡和发挥CompactFlash的优点。但是这种卡进入嵌入式市场的速度不会很快,由于PCIExpress将涉及硬件支持形式和特点的重大改变,对现有板卡的板形标准仍待制定4。由于PCIExpress技术卓越的特性,很多公司都投入了大量的精力来促进该技术的推广。在2003年秋天的Intel开发论坛上,PLX第一个演示了基于PCIExpress的ATCAAdvancedTelecomComputingArchitecture系统。各芯片组厂商也忙于开发支持PCIExpress的芯片。Mellanox技术公司已经公布了相关的芯片产品。Intel的i915PGrantsdale和i925×Alderwood芯片组将包括用于图形的×16连接,并支持333/400MHz的DDR和400/533MHz的DDR2。Intel的南桥芯片ICH6将有4条PCIExpress×1连接和4个串行ATA150端口。ICH6的俗称是Azalia,可以为PC提供192KHz,32位的多通道音频支持。威盛的北桥芯片保存了传统的AGP支持,其新的VT8251南桥芯片还将包括两个×1PCIExpress连接,4个串行ATA端口,Gb级以太网和8通道192KHz,24位音频支持。SiS的第一代PCIExpress南桥芯片SiS965L将包括两个×1连接,8通道音频,两个串行ATA端口和Gb级以太网支持。该公司已经量产SiS965和9652南桥芯片。VIA和Ali也方案今年第3季度量产PCIExpress南桥芯片VT8251和M1573。PCIExpress的卓越特性及Intel公司的大力推广,使得PCIExpress技术已经得到业界的广泛认可,相信以后它必将取代如今的PCI总线并成为新的主流的内部互联总线并在嵌入式系统及相关领域中大显身手。参考文献:1.:/163,浅谈PCIExpress及其技术分析。2.:/eerchina,com,走向点到点的互连-从PCI、PCI-X到PCI-Express。3.PLXTechnology,December,2003,HighPerformanceI/OInterConnectPCIExpressTechnologySeminar。4.电子产品世界,2004.8,2004是PCIExpress和总线移植年。